While Okinawa Main Island (Okinawa Honto) is not considered to have the prefecture's very best beaches (these are found on smaller islands such as Miyako ), it, nevertheless, has some attractive beaches where visitors can enjoy the sun, sand and sea. The view from Tamatorizaki Observation Point Beaches. Ishigaki Island has both sandy beaches and rocky beaches which are covered in small pieces of bleached coral. A 3.5-kilometre sandbar stretching south across the Asoumi Sea from the town of Miyazu, Amanohashidate's beaches are located around 100 km northwest of Kyoto on Japan's main island of Honshu. Emerald Beach is located within the Ocean Expo Park on the Motobu Peninsula. Situated at the northern end of the Ocean Expo Park, Emerald Beach is a family friendly "Y" shaped coral sand beach separated into three sections: Playing, resting and viewing. Hoshizuna-no-Hama, which in English translates to "sand in the shape of a star," is a lovely beach on an island in Okinawa, Japan. The little five and six-point stars concealed beneath the sands are a unique characteristic of this beach sanctuary surrounded by crystal blue seas. Mar 26, 2019 · On a map, the major Okinawa islands look a little like a long disjointed tail off southern Japan that whips toward the southwest. Naha, the capital, lies roughly at the center of the group in southern Okinawa Honto, the largest island. Kume, known as a resort island with beautiful beaches, is about 60 miles west of Okinawa Honto.

Getting to Tokashiki Island. Tokashiki Island is reached by ferry from Okinawa’s main island. High-speed and regular ferries run from Tomari Port in Naha City. The high-speed Marine Liner has two or three departures per day (depending on the season) and takes 35 minutes. The Folklore Behind Japanese Star-Shaped Sand. Star-shaped sands, or “hoshizuna,” are a natural wonder found on select beaches in Okinawa, Japan. Shirahama Beach is the most famous of many nice beaches on the Izu Peninsula, many of which are near the peninsula's southern tip. The white sand beach is about 800 meters long with facilities like showers, changing rooms and toilets and shops nearby. The beach is also known for relatively good surfing conditions. ….
